Задать вопрос
serii81
@serii81
Я люблю phр...

В чем ошибка с svg?

Экспортирую svg из иллюстратора, на выходе получается файл 1.svg, когда пытаюсь оптимизировать его через gulp:
gulp.task('svg', function () {
return gulp.src('src/svg/*.svg')
.pipe(svgmin({
js2svg: {
pretty: true
}
}))
.pipe(gulp.dest('src/svgmin/'));
});
то выводит такая ошибка:

$ gulp svg
[23:12:01] Using gulpfile D:\WEB\OpenServer\domains\ArmataFin\gulpfile.js
[23:12:01] Starting 'svg'...

events.js:160
throw er; // Unhandled 'error' event
^
Error: Error in parsing SVG: Invalid character entity
Line: 2
Column: 51
Char: ;

Не могу понять в чем проблема, gulp просто ругается на эти изображения и не пропускает через себя?
  • Вопрос задан
  • 158 просмотров
Подписаться 1 Оценить Комментировать
Решения вопроса 1
serii81
@serii81 Автор вопроса
Я люблю phр...
Нашел ответ. Поковырялся в коде самих изображений, потом в самом иллюстраторе и заметил, что не перевел обводку в кривые. Поэтому gulp и ругался. Да, мне эта ошибка запомнится надолго)))
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ы